- Connect the Gray/Black wire to the right front negative speaker output of the aftermarket radio.
- Connect the Green wire to the radio's left rear positive speaker output.
- Connect the Green/Black wire to the radio's left rear negative speaker output.
- Connect the Purple wire to the radio's right rear positive speaker output.
- Connect the Purple/Black wire to the radio's right rear negative speaker output.
The following (3) wires are for the aftermarket radios that have navigation built in.
- Connect the Light Green wire to the parking brake wire of the aftermarket navigation radio (if applicable).
- Connect the Blue/Pink wire to the VSS or speed sense wire of the aftermarket navigation radio (if applicable).
- Connect the Green/Purple wire to the reverse wire of the aftermarket navigation radio (if applicable).
INITIALIZING THE XSVI-1788-NAV
Attention! If the interface loses power for any reason, the following steps will need to be performed again. Also, if installing an ASWC-1 connect it after you initialize and test the interface/radio, with the key in the off position.
- Turn the key (or push-to-start button) to the ignition position and wait until the radio comes on.
Note: If the radio does not come on within 60 seconds, turn the key to the off position, disconnect the interface, check all connections, reconnect the interface, and then try again. - Turn the key to the off position, and then to the accessory position. Test all functions of the installation for proper operation, before reassembling the dash.

XSVI-1788-NAV
Dodge Sprinter 2008-2009 /
Freightliner Sprinter 2008-up
Accessory and NAV Output CAN Interface
FEATURES
- Provides accessory power (12-volt 10-amp)
• Retains R.A.P. (retained accessory power) - Provides NAV outputs (parking brake, reverse, and speed sense)
- Prewired ASWC-1 harness (ASWC-1 sold separately)
• Retains balance and fade - USB updatable
CAUTION! All accessories, switches, climate controls panels, and especially air bag indicator lights must be connected before cycling the ignition. Also, do not remove the factory radio with the key in the on position, or while the vehicle is running.
Connections to be made
- Connect the Yellow wire to the radio's 12 volt battery or memory wire.
- Connect the Black wire to the radio's ground wire.
- Connect the Red wire to the ignition wire of the aftermarket radio.
- Connect the Orange wire to the illumination wire of the aftermarket radio. If the aftermarket radio has no illumination wire, tape off the Orange wire.
- Connect the Blue wire to the antenna turn on wire of the aftermarket radio.
- Connect the White wire to the left front positive speaker output of the aftermarket radio.
- Connect the White/Black wire to the left front negative speaker output of the aftermarket radio.
- Connect the Gray wire to the right front positive speaker output of the aftermarket radio.
